From: Matthias Clasen Date: Fri, 27 Feb 2004 00:49:56 +0000 (+0000) Subject: Support parsing of intializers containing macros with arguments. (#129717) X-Git-Url: http://git.openbox.org/?a=commitdiff_plain;h=5c57631f690d07bd4aaf990c3bee54d4c479ea4d;p=dana%2Fcg-glib.git Support parsing of intializers containing macros with arguments. (#129717) Fri Feb 27 01:49:22 2004 Matthias Clasen * glib-mkenums.in: Support parsing of intializers containing macros with arguments. (#129717) --- diff --git a/gobject/glib-mkenums.in b/gobject/glib-mkenums.in index 1643fd62..969c84a2 100755 --- a/gobject/glib-mkenums.in +++ b/gobject/glib-mkenums.in @@ -83,7 +83,9 @@ sub parse_entries { if (m@^\s* (\w+)\s* # name (?:=( # value - (?:[^,/]|/(?!\*))* + \s*\w+\s*\(.*\)\s* # macro with multiple args + | # OR + (?:[^,/]|/(?!\*))* # anything but a comma or comment ))?,?\s* (?:/\*< # options (([^*]|\*(?!/))*)